Remarks & Notes 
Going thru all my slide, I would definitely say this vehicle train from McCook, IL, to Oklahoma City, OK, was the money train for me in 1995-96. This train got some cool ass power alot of the days, and it ran in decent light across the west end of the Chilly and east end of the Marceline. As is this day, 4 little blue and yellows pull hard as they snake out of the Des Moines Valley east of Revere. The train has just crossed into Missouri about 5 miles back and is fighting the .7% grade up to Revere. The train is about 20 miles west of Ft. Madison, IA.
